前面我們已經提到過,ASP.NET 的路由系統主要具有兩個方面的應用,其一就是通過注冊URL模板與物理文件路徑的匹配實現請求地址和物理地址的分離;另一個則是通過注冊的路由規測生成一個相應的URL。后者通過調用RouteCollection類型的GetVirtualPath方法來實現。[源代碼從這 ...
tp開戶路由后,使用U方法是不會按路由規則生成url的,一般我們是要手動修改模版,把里面的U方法去掉,手動修改鏈接,如果是已經寫好的程序,后期才添加路由,修改起鏈接就太麻煩了 今天無聊就修改了一下U方法,讓它按路由規則生成url,再不用一條條修改模版了哈哈哈哈哈哈 下面代碼添加到 ThinkPHP Common functions.php 文件U方法里,大概 行 if suffix 前面 : ...
2017-01-20 16:30 0 2014 推薦指數:
前面我們已經提到過,ASP.NET 的路由系統主要具有兩個方面的應用,其一就是通過注冊URL模板與物理文件路徑的匹配實現請求地址和物理地址的分離;另一個則是通過注冊的路由規測生成一個相應的URL。后者通過調用RouteCollection類型的GetVirtualPath方法來實現。[源代碼從這 ...
thinkphp5 生成URL地址方法 定義路由規則之后,我們可以通過Url類來方便的生成實際的URL地址(路由地址),針對上面的路由規則,我們可以用下面的方式生成URL地址。 echo Url::build('url12' ,’a=1&b=2' ); echo url ...
一.入口模塊修改 修改public下的index 加入 define('BIND_MODULE','admin'); 即可將入門模塊綁定到admin模塊 二.路由美化 在conf 目錄創建route.php 1.開啟路由配置 2.在conf目錄新建 ...
前面的話 本文將詳細介紹thinkphp5URL和路由 URL訪問 ThinkPHP采用單一入口模式訪問應用,對應用的所有請求都定向到應用的入口文件,系統會從URL參數中解析當前請求的模塊、控制器和操作,下面是一個標准的URL訪問格式 ...
ThinkPHP中U方法的用處主要是完成對url地址的組裝,在模板中使用U方法而不是固定寫死URL地址的好處在於,一旦你的環境變化或者參數設置改變,你不需要更改模板中的任何代碼。在模板中的調用格式需要采用 {:U('地址', '參數'…)} 的方式,一般的形式里面是控制器中的方法 ...
#!/usr/bin/env python # encoding: utf-8 """ @version: v1.0 @author: cxa @file: flask02.py @time: 2018/04/13 14:55 """ """ 要給 URL 添加變量部分 ...
Routing的作用:它首先是獲取到View傳過來的請求,並解析Url請求中Controller和Action以及數據,其次他將識別出來的數據傳遞給Controller的Action(Controller的方法)。這是Routing組件的兩個重要的作用! 下面我們從幾個例子來講解一下Url路由 ...
Thinkphp是一個體系較為完整的框架,很多地方比國外的框架功能都全,唯一不喜之處是性能,和傳說中的.NET有點像。 Thinkphp提供較全url處理體系,通過同一規則實現Url的路由和Url生成,Url的生成是通過U('',[])函數獲取的。當我在一個Thinkphp中建立兩個 ...